| ## Troubleshooting Test Issues |
|
|
| ### Common Test Failures |
|
|
| **1. Database Connection Errors** |
| ``` |
| Error: sqlite3.OperationalError: database is locked |
| ``` |
| **Solution:** Ensure no other processes are using the test database, or use a unique database file for each test run. |
|
|
| **2. Selenium WebDriver Issues** |
| ``` |
| Error: selenium.common.exceptions.WebDriverException: chrome not reachable |
| ``` |
| **Solution:** Install Chrome/Chromium, update ChromeDriver, or run tests in headless mode. |
|
|
| **3. API Timeout Errors** |
| ``` |
| Error: requests.exceptions.ConnectTimeout: HTTPSConnectionPool |
| ``` |
| **Solution:** Increase timeout values, check service startup, verify network connectivity. |
|
|
| **4. Memory Issues During Testing** |
| ``` |
| Error: MemoryError: Unable to allocate array |
| ``` |
| **Solution:** Reduce test data size, increase system memory, or run tests in smaller batches. |

| ## Best Practices |
|
|
| ### Writing Effective Tests |
|
|
| 1. **Test Naming Convention:** |
| ```python |
| def test_should_extract_claims_when_given_valid_text(): |
| # Test implementation |
| ``` |
|
|
| 2. **Arrange-Act-Assert Pattern:** |
| ```python |
| def test_nlp_analysis(): |
| # Arrange |
| analyzer = NLPAnalyzer() |
| text = "Sample misinformation text" |
| |
| # Act |
| result = analyzer.analyze(text) |
| |
| # Assert |
| assert result.claims is not None |
| assert len(result.claims) > 0 |
| ``` |
|
|
| 3. **Use Fixtures for Common Setup:** |
| ```python |
| @pytest.fixture |
| def sample_event(): |
| return { |
| "text": "Test event text", |
| "source": "test", |
| "location": "Maharashtra" |
| } |
| ``` |
|
|
| 4. **Mock External Dependencies:** |
| ```python |
| @patch('backend.satellite_client.requests.get') |
| def test_satellite_validation(mock_get): |
| mock_get.return_value.json.return_value = {"similarity": 0.8} |
| # Test implementation |
| ``` |
